import { mkdir, readFile, writeFile } from "node:fs/promises";
import { dirname } from "node:path";
import { exists } from "./utils.mjs";
const SISYPHUS_MARKETPLACE_SOURCE = {
sourceType: "git",
source: "https://github.com/sisyphuslabs/omo.git",
ref: "main",
};
const LEGACY_CODEX_PLUGIN_MARKETPLACE = ["code", "yeongyu", "codex", "plugins"].join("-");
const SISYPHUS_LEGACY_MARKETPLACES = ["lazycodex", LEGACY_CODEX_PLUGIN_MARKETPLACE];
export async function updateCodexConfig({
configPath,
repoRoot,
marketplaceName,
marketplaceSource = defaultMarketplaceSource(marketplaceName, repoRoot),
pluginNames,
trustedHookStates = [],
agentConfigs = [],
}) {
await mkdir(dirname(configPath), { recursive: true });
let config = "";
if (await exists(configPath)) config = await readFile(configPath, "utf8");
for (const legacyMarketplaceName of legacyMarketplaceNames(marketplaceName)) {
config = removeMarketplaceBlock(config, legacyMarketplaceName);
config = removeStaleMarketplacePluginBlocks(config, legacyMarketplaceName, new Set());
config = removeStaleMarketplaceHookStateBlocks(config, legacyMarketplaceName, new Set());
}
config = removeStaleMarketplacePluginBlocks(config, marketplaceName, new Set(pluginNames));
config = removeStaleMarketplaceHookStateBlocks(config, marketplaceName, new Set(pluginNames));
config = ensureFeatureEnabled(config, "plugins");
config = ensureFeatureEnabled(config, "plugin_hooks");
config = ensureMarketplaceBlock(config, marketplaceName, marketplaceSource);
for (const pluginName of pluginNames) {
config = ensurePluginEnabled(config, `${pluginName}@${marketplaceName}`);
}
for (const state of trustedHookStates) {
config = ensureHookTrusted(config, state.key, state.trustedHash);
}
for (const agentConfig of agentConfigs) {
config = ensureAgentConfig(config, agentConfig);
}
await writeFile(configPath, config.trimEnd() + "\n");
}
function legacyMarketplaceNames(marketplaceName) {
return marketplaceName === "sisyphuslabs" ? SISYPHUS_LEGACY_MARKETPLACES : [];
}
function removeMarketplaceBlock(config, marketplaceName) {
return removeTomlSections(config, (header) => header === `marketplaces.${marketplaceName}`);
}
function defaultMarketplaceSource(marketplaceName, repoRoot) {
if (marketplaceName === "sisyphuslabs") return SISYPHUS_MARKETPLACE_SOURCE;
return {
sourceType: "local",
source: repoRoot,
};
}
function removeStaleMarketplacePluginBlocks(config, marketplaceName, keepPluginNames) {
return removeTomlSections(config, (header) => {
const pluginKey = parsePluginHeaderKey(header);
if (pluginKey === null) return false;
const suffix = `@${marketplaceName}`;
if (!pluginKey.endsWith(suffix)) return false;
return !keepPluginNames.has(pluginKey.slice(0, -suffix.length));
});
}
function removeStaleMarketplaceHookStateBlocks(config, marketplaceName, keepPluginNames) {
return removeTomlSections(config, (header) => {
const prefix = "hooks.state.";
if (!header.startsWith(prefix)) return false;
const hookKey = parseJsonString(header.slice(prefix.length));
if (hookKey === null) return false;
const separator = hookKey.indexOf(":");
if (separator === -1) return false;
const pluginKey = hookKey.slice(0, separator);
const suffix = `@${marketplaceName}`;
if (!pluginKey.endsWith(suffix)) return false;
return !keepPluginNames.has(pluginKey.slice(0, -suffix.length));
});
}
function ensureFeatureEnabled(config, featureName) {
const section = findTomlSection(config, "features");
if (!section) return appendBlock(config, `[features]\n${featureName} = true\n`);
return replaceOrInsertSetting(config, section, featureName, "true");
}
function ensureMarketplaceBlock(config, marketplaceName, source) {
const header = `marketplaces.${marketplaceName}`;
const block = [
`[${header}]`,
`last_updated = "${new Date().toISOString().replace(/\.\d{3}Z$/, "Z")}"`,
`source_type = ${JSON.stringify(source.sourceType)}`,
`source = ${JSON.stringify(source.source)}`,
source.ref === undefined ? null : `ref = ${JSON.stringify(source.ref)}`,
"",
].filter((line) => line !== null).join("\n");
const section = findTomlSection(config, header);
if (section) return config.slice(0, section.start) + block + config.slice(section.end);
return appendBlock(config, block);
}
function ensurePluginEnabled(config, pluginKey) {
const header = `plugins.${JSON.stringify(pluginKey)}`;
const section = findTomlSection(config, header);
if (!section) return appendBlock(config, `[${header}]\nenabled = true\n`);
return replaceOrInsertSetting(config, section, "enabled", "true");
}
function ensureHookTrusted(config, key, trustedHash) {
const header = `hooks.state.${JSON.stringify(key)}`;
const section = findTomlSection(config, header);
if (!section) return appendBlock(config, `[${header}]\ntrusted_hash = ${JSON.stringify(trustedHash)}\n`);
return replaceOrInsertSetting(config, section, "trusted_hash", JSON.stringify(trustedHash));
}
function ensureAgentConfig(config, agentConfig) {
const header = `agents.${tomlKeySegment(agentConfig.name)}`;
const section = findTomlSection(config, header);
const configFile = JSON.stringify(agentConfig.configFile);
if (!section) return appendBlock(config, `[${header}]\nconfig_file = ${configFile}\n`);
return replaceOrInsertSetting(config, section, "config_file", configFile);
}
function tomlKeySegment(value) {
return /^[A-Za-z0-9_-]+$/.test(value) ? value : JSON.stringify(value);
}
function removeTomlSections(config, shouldRemove) {
return splitTomlSections(config)
.filter((section) => section.header === null || !shouldRemove(section.header))
.map((section) => section.text)
.join("")
.replace(/\n{3,}/g, "\n\n");
}
function splitTomlSections(config) {
const lines = config.match(/[^\n]*\n?|$/g) ?? [];
const sections = [];
let current = { header: null, text: "" };
for (const line of lines) {
if (line.length === 0) break;
const header = parseTomlHeader(line);
if (header !== null) {
if (current.text.length > 0) sections.push(current);
current = { header, text: line };
} else {
current.text += line;
}
}
if (current.text.length > 0) sections.push(current);
return sections;
}
function findTomlSection(config, header) {
const headerLine = `[${header}]`;
const lines = config.match(/[^\n]*\n?|$/g) ?? [];
let offset = 0;
let start = -1;
for (const line of lines) {
if (line.length === 0) break;
const trimmed = line.trim();
if (start === -1) {
if (trimmed === headerLine) start = offset;
} else if (trimmed.startsWith("[") && trimmed.endsWith("]")) {
return { start, end: offset, text: config.slice(start, offset) };
}
offset += line.length;
}
if (start === -1) return null;
return { start, end: config.length, text: config.slice(start) };
}
function replaceOrInsertSetting(config, section, key, value) {
const linePattern = new RegExp(`^${escapeRegExp(key)}\\s*=.*$`, "m");
const replacement = linePattern.test(section.text)
? section.text.replace(linePattern, `${key} = ${value}`)
: insertSetting(section.text, key, value);
return config.slice(0, section.start) + replacement + config.slice(section.end);
}
function insertSetting(sectionText, key, value) {
const lines = sectionText.split("\n");
lines.splice(1, 0, `${key} = ${value}`);
return lines.join("\n");
}
function parseTomlHeader(line) {
const trimmed = line.trim();
if (!trimmed.startsWith("[") || !trimmed.endsWith("]")) return null;
if (trimmed.startsWith("[[")) return null;
return trimmed.slice(1, -1);
}
function parsePluginHeaderKey(header) {
const prefix = "plugins.";
if (!header.startsWith(prefix)) return null;
return parseLeadingJsonString(header.slice(prefix.length));
}
function parseLeadingJsonString(value) {
if (!value.startsWith('"')) return parseJsonString(value);
let escaped = false;
for (let index = 1; index < value.length; index += 1) {
const char = value[index];
if (escaped) {
escaped = false;
continue;
}
if (char === "\\") {
escaped = true;
continue;
}
if (char === '"') return parseJsonString(value.slice(0, index + 1));
}
return null;
}
function parseJsonString(value) {
try {
const parsed = JSON.parse(value);
return typeof parsed === "string" ? parsed : null;
} catch {
return null;
}
}
function appendBlock(config, block) {
const prefix = config.trimEnd();
return `${prefix}${prefix.length > 0 ? "\n\n" : ""}${block.trimEnd()}\n`;
}
function escapeRegExp(value) {
return value.replace(/[.*+?^${}()|[\]\\]/g, "\\$&");
}
